Hitchhiker Robs/Rapes Two Female Passengers: Ndwedwe – KZN
Two females were robbed and raped by a hitchhiker in Mavela, Ndwedwe – KZN during the early hours of this morning (Saturday).
At approximately 06:30, a male motorist was transporting two females from Verulam – KZN to Ndwedwe – KZN when he offered a lift to three other individuals along the route. The trio consisted of one male and two females. The hitchhikers were allegedly consuming alcohol at the time. The two female hitchhikers were later dropped off in Mavela, Ndwedwe, while the male requested to be dropped off further along the route.
While travelling, the male hitchhiker allegedly produced a firearm and instructed the driver to turn onto an unpaved road. Upon reaching a dead end, the suspect robbed the driver of an undisclosed amount of cash and a Samsung cellphone. The driver was then instructed to abandon his white Suzuki Dzire and flee the scene. He was not physically injured.
The perpetrator thereafter forced the two female passengers down an embankment toward a nearby river, where he robbed them of their cellphones before raping both victims. The suspect then fled into dense bushes in the area.
The driver managed to obtain assistance from the community who contacted authorities for assistance. The man was unable to provide the location of his two female passengers.
A joint search operation was conducted by members of Reaction Unit South Africa (RUSA) & the Ndwedwe SAPS in KZN, resulting in the two female victims being located approximately one kilometre from the main road in a bushy area.
